The Delta Group in the United Kingdom seeks an experienced Personal Assistant to provide dedicated one‑to‑one support to the Executive Chairman and family.

The role covers personal, household and family office matters, with a smaller share of business-related admin.

Confidentiality, discretion and trust are essential for success. Based at the Executive Chairman's home in Stapleford Tawney, Essex, the role is on-site with some remote tasks.
